Marine Mortar: What It Is and Why It Matters

Marine mortar uses sulphate-resisting Portland cement rather than ordinary Portland cement. This resists the salt crystallisation mechanism that physically fractures standard mortar joints from within. On exposed PR8 coastal properties within half a mile of the seafront, standard repointing mortar has an effective life of three to five years. Marine mortar extends this to twelve or more years in the same conditions.

Lead Flashing: Repair vs Full Replacement

We do not patch corroded lead with sealant or flash tape as a permanent repair. Sealant on corroded lead provides a temporary seal that fails again within one to three winters. Full lead replacement — correctly lapped, dressed and clipped — is the repair that lasts. If we have stripped the flashing and the lead is pitted or thinned, we replace it. This is stated in the written quote before work begins.

Our Process

What to Expect From a Chimney Repair

Full Stack Assessment

Chimney repairs begin with a close-up assessment of all four stack elevations from the roof surface. We check mortar joint recession depth, brick face condition, lead flashing integrity at all step and soaker positions, and chimney pot condition. A written assessment is provided with the quote.

Correct Mortar Specification

The mortar we specify depends on three factors: the brick hardness (assessed by scratch test on site), the salt air exposure level of the property, and whether conservation area or listed building constraints apply. We state the mortar specification in the written quote — not 'standard mix'.

Lead Work

All chimney lead flashing replacement uses grade-4 lead as a minimum. We cut, dress and step all lead manually on site. No sealant or flash tape is used as a primary repair — these materials have a service life of 1–3 years in coastal conditions and we do not quote for work we know will fail within this timeframe.

Canal-Side Properties

Properties backing onto or fronting the Leeds-Liverpool Canal — particularly those on Navigation Lane and the surrounding streets — face a humidity environment that creates faster biological growth on roof surfaces and accelerated joint deterioration in guttering systems. The canal-side microclimate is not as aggressive as salt air, but it is measurably more demanding than dry inland positions for moss growth and mortar joint water absorption. We note canal proximity in every Burscough survey and adjust maintenance frequency recommendations accordingly.

Frost-Resistant Specification

Burscough's flat, low-lying position on the west Lancashire plain creates frost-pocket conditions that are relevant to every chimney pointing job we carry out in the area. We specify frost-resistant mortar — either marine mortar with sulphate-resisting Portland cement, or NHL lime for Victorian soft brick — on all Burscough chimney work as a matter of course, not only on the most exposed properties. The additional material cost is negligible relative to the improvement in service life in a hard-frost position.
